Llewellyn, G., McConnell, D., Honey, A., Mayes, R., & Russo, D. (2003). Promoting health and home safety for children of parents with intellectual disability: A randomized controlled trial. Research in Developmental Disabilities, 24(6), 405-431.
Model(s) Reviewed: Australian adaptation of the UCLA Parent-Child Health and Wellness Project, a version of SafeCare
Moderate rating
Study reviewed under: Handbook of Procedures and Standards, Version 1
